Wool as material
Wool is a natural and durable material that breathes, warms and is comfortable to wear.
Why wool?
Wool keeps you warm when it's cold and cools you when it's hot. Perfect for both everyday life and outdoor life.
Nature's own High Tech
The wool fibers transport away sweat and bad odors. So you stay both dry and warm. A magical combination of comfort and function.
Wool washes itself
Thanks to wool's self-cleaning properties, you don't need to wash it as often. You save both time and energy. Win-win.

In 1946, the knitting machines move into the attic.
When Martin Göthager founded the company in 1946, the focus was on designing and knitting women's clothing, then under the name Gällstads Ylle. Martin had worked in knitting factories for a long time but was driven by his own ideas. Together with two companions, he mortgaged his house, bought knitting machines and installed them in the attic. With inspiration from Paris, material was knitted which Mrs. Ragnhild then sewed up. Soon, Gällstad's wool was a sought-after garment that was worn throughout Sweden. And the journey had only just begun.

New name, sport in focus and a driven brotherhood.
In the 70s, skiing is hotter than ever. Stenmark is a hero and all of Sweden wants to go downhill. At the same time, the small company in Gällstad takes the opportunity to change direction. Now it is sport that matters and the international market that attracts. The name is changed to Ivanhoe and the machines go into high gear. The knitted sweater is quickly becoming a must-have for all ski enthusiasts. In addition, there is a generational shift - sons Lars-Erik, Ulf and Göran take over from father Martin. And the brothers will drive the company forward for 40 years.

Wool, sustainability and another generation.
Under the siblings Anna, Anders and Karin, product development is refined to revolve around natural materials - and above all wool. The factory in Gällstad is still the starting point of the business and 90% of the garments are designed and knitted on site. When the company celebrates 75 years in 2021, it takes the opportunity to relaunch the classic ski sweater - a nod to the knitted woolen fashion of the 70s. The business constantly continues to develop in order to meet the conscious customers of tomorrow. And the innovative family spirit lives on in every decision.
